NK agrees to suspend nuclear activities, allow inspectors
Feb 29, 2012
WASHINGTON (AP) _ The United States said Wednesday North Korea has agreed to suspend nuclear activities and a moratorium on nuclear, and long-range missile tests in a breakthrough in negotiations with the secretive communist nation.
